A main air conditioner cools air in one spot before dispersing it throughout the home using the furnace’s air handling abilities. This sets it apart from window or wall ac system or mini-split systems, which all chill reasonably tiny areas and need many units to cool the whole home.
Many single-family houses in the United States with central air conditioning utilize a split system. This implies that the device is divided into 2 parts: an evaporator coil within a compressor and the house outside.

Your specialist will help you in figuring out the suitable size central air conditioner for your house. A unit that is too small will run virtually continuously, whereas a system that is too large will chill the home too quickly and turn off before completing a full cycle.
The fast on/off in the latter scenario is taxing on the system. It can trigger the evaporator coil to freeze, and a frozen coil prevents air from flowing. As a result, a big ac system might be less efficient at cooling than a smaller sized system.
Your Air Conditioner installation will do a calculation referred to as a “Manual-J” to determine finest system for your house. This will consider all of the parameters we’ve pointed out and more, resulting in the most precise size possible.
Nevertheless, we comprehend that numerous homeowners like to have a general notion of what size they need ahead of time. central air conditioning conditioner size: To get the Btu necessary, multiply the square footage of your home’s conditioned location by 25, then divide by 12,000 to acquire the tonnage.
Keep in mind that this is simply a standard price quote, and there are numerous aspects. If your home’s first floor has 12-foot ceilings, the air conditioner will have more air to chill.

Prices vary based on the regional market and the task information, as with any considerable job. For labor and materials, a normal split system central air installation using an existing heater could cost in between $3,000 and $7,000 or more. Usually, that cost will be split around 60/40, with labor accounting for most of it.
